What is the Canadian Dollar (CAD)

The Canadian dollar, often affectionately referred to as the “loonie” by English-speaking Canadians, serves as the official currency of Canada. This unique nickname owes its origins to the image of the common loon, a bird that graces the one-dollar coin, known as the “loonie.” Beyond its cultural significance, the Canadian dollar also carries economic weight, accounting for approximately 2% of all global currency reserves, reflecting Canada's standing in the global financial landscape.

One interesting facet of Canadian currency slang is the shared usage of “buck” by Canadian-English and American-English speakers. This colloquial term dates back to the 17th century when Hudson's Bay Company introduced a coin known as the “buck.” Its value was equated to a male beaver's pelt, emphasizing the historical significance of the fur trade in North America. In contrast, Canadian-French speakers have their own terms, such as “piastre” and “huard,” adding linguistic diversity to the cultural tapestry of Canadian currency. This rich history and cultural blend behind the Canadian dollar make it a fascinating subject of exploration.

Key Facts about the Canadian Dollar

The Canadian dollar (CAD), serving as the official currency of Canada, holds a unique position in the country's economic and cultural landscape. Affectionately referred to as the “loonie,” the Canadian dollar derives its nickname from the image of the common loon, an iconic bird featured on the one-dollar coin. Divided into 100 cents, the currency is represented by the symbol “$” or “C$.” Canadian banknotes are issued in various denominations, with portraits of notable Canadians and symbols of national importance gracing the designs. The current series of banknotes notably features Queen Elizabeth II, symbolizing Canada's constitutional monarchy. With advanced security features, including holograms and transparent windows, Canadian currency is designed to deter counterfeiting.

The Canadian dollar is not only a domestic currency but also a global player. It holds significance as one of the world's major reserve currencies and is widely used in international trade and finance. Its exchange rate fluctuates in the foreign exchange market, influenced by a variety of economic indicators and global market conditions. Canadian coins carry unique names like the “loonie” and the “toonie,” contributing to the rich linguistic tapestry of the country. With its history, cultural references, and economic importance, the Canadian dollar is an integral part of Canada's identity and prosperity.

Canadian Dollar (CAD)
Symbols $, CA$, Can$, C$
Nicknames: Loonie, buck, Huard, piastre
ISO 4217 code: CAD
Central Bank: Bank of Canada
Currency Subunits: Cent = 1/100
Banknote Denominations: $5, $10, $20, $50, $100
Coin Denominations: Coins: 5¢, 10¢, 25¢, $1, $2
Countries using this currency: Canada

Canadian Dollar – History and Tradition

history icon

The history of the Canadian dollar is a tapestry woven with traditions and significant milestones. Its journey began in 1858, and over the years, it underwent a series of transformations, ultimately culminating in a pivotal moment in 1970 when it became a floating currency. However, the currency's historical significance stretches back to the early 19th century. In 1821, the Bank of Montreal issued the first banknotes, marking a crucial step in the evolution of the Canadian financial system. These banknotes would become the primary form of payment and a symbol of trust in the emerging Canadian economy.

Another significant date in the currency's history was 1851 when the “pound sterling” was introduced into circulation. This marked a shift in the way Canadians conducted their financial transactions and represented a significant departure from the British pounds used until that point. Subsequent events in the currency's evolution included the adoption of the gold standard, which added stability to the financial system. The replacement of the Canadian pound with the Canadian dollar, aligned with the U.S. dollar, further solidified the currency's identity. Finally, the establishment of the Bank of Canada in 1934 as the country's central financial authority marked a defining moment in Canada's economic landscape, paving the way for the modern Canadian dollar we know today. The rich history and traditions of the Canadian dollar reflect its journey from humble beginnings to a symbol of Canadian economic strength and stability.

Can I set deposit and spending limits at Canadian Dollar casinos?

Yes, many Canadian Dollar (CAD) casinos provide responsible gambling tools that allow players to set deposit and spending limits. These features are designed to promote safe and controlled gaming experiences. Here's how you can typically utilize these limits:

Deposit Limits: Most CAD casinos enable players to set da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limits. Once you reach your self-imposed limit, you won't be able to deposit more until the specified time period has passed. It's an effective way to manage your budget and prevent excessive spending.

Spending Limits: Some casinos also allow players to set limits on their total spending, including both deposits and losses. Once you reach this limit, you won't be able to place additional bets or continue playing until the chosen timeframe is over.

By using these tools, you can enjoy the entertainment and excitement of CAD casinos while maintaining full control over your gambling activities. It's a responsible and proactive approach to ensure that gaming remains a fun and enjoyable experience.
